Output ffac32120c623344268b365bf3fcba6e266371b41e192e14ba271168eca9114f:1

value
2089530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 61debe265c3c1e14965a16d4191205af04148ee5 OP_EQUALVERIFY OP_CHECKSIG
address
19vVP3iC3jHdT3LHedMySpf3z7YvXNZ2Qg
transaction
ffac32120c623344268b365bf3fcba6e266371b41e192e14ba271168eca9114f
spent
true